Successful intelligence refers to the ability to acknowledge our own capabilities and utilize it to accomplish personal/meaningful goals in our career.
In her teaching method, Ms. Stilton encouraged the students to form their own personal opinion and make an effort to defend it against other students who might have different opinion. When they grow up, this type of skills will be useful in their professional career because they have to constantly involved in office politics and engagement with competitors to win over their consumers.
